Just in case today's NSFW trailer for the Deadpool sequel was a bit much for the very young or squeamish among you, Fox has debuted a green-band version which does away with the F-bombs, overly crude gags, and bloody violence.

That aside, it's pretty much the same - but we do get an additional couple of shots of The Merc With a Mouth (Ryan Reynolds) throwing down with Cable (Josh Brolin); and while the time-travelling mutant badass seemed firmly in control in the red-band teaser, Wade definitely looks to be laying down a beating here.

Check it out below, and let us know what you think.

Deadpool 2 is set to hit theaters on May 18.
